This page is all about using up your stash. A few diecuts, some scraps of paper, OLD paper getting used up, digging through embellies I don't want to put away, and experimenting, with Smooch Accent Ink in this case. I hope you enjoy it! 

Like I said in the video, I don't particularly love single photo layouts because they are not practical to those of us scrapping for not just the love of creating but also to save our memories. Even though this page has one mat, I can include more photos using a strip of smaller images or use the mat to hold 2 smaller pics. Consider ways to adapt single photo designs to include more photos.

We all do it. We have those tools we buy and maybe we love them for a month or two, or maybe they are still in the package, but the bottom line is that we are not using them to their full potential, as often as we ought to, and not getting our money's worth out of them. 

One of the tools I stopped using regularly was my Silhouette Cameo Machine. I moved a coffee table form my guest room into my family room, set up the ameo on it and set up my laptop on a TV tray. And while I was watching TV, I made some files and then started cutting them on the Silhouette. I started with some paper I wasn't too in love with, just to get the feel of it back. 







Today's page uses those elements I cut from the Silhouette Cameo. It feels really good to get out a tool and USE it! What tool or product did you buy that you wish you used more?
